The details in each mode are as follows.
AUTO
Component
AUTO:
When there are multiple input signals, the input signals are
detected and the input signal to be output from the video
monitor output terminal is selected automatically in the
following order: component video, S-Video, composite video.

Component:
The signal connected to the component video terminal is
always played.

Video conversion is not conducted, so no image is output
from the monitor output terminal when there is no input
signal to the component terminal.
S-Video:
The signal connected to the S-Video terminal is always played.
The S-Video input signal is converted and output from the
composite and component monitor output terminal.
Video:
The signal connected to the composite video terminal is
always played.

Setting the Auto Tuner Preset

Use this to automatically search for FM broadcasts and store up
to 56 stations at preset channels A1 to 8, B1 to 8, C1 to 8, D1 to
8, E1 to 8, F1 to 8 and G1 to 8.
